Dive into theatre and acrobatics at La Perle

Dubai's resident aqua stage show at Al Habtoor City is an experience you must see to believe.

Masterminded by theatre extraordinaire Franco Dragone, La Perle's mysterious storyline, talented performers and state-of-the-art aqua theatre are making waves at the city's first permanent show. 

Since opening in August 2017, the live aqua show, which takes place in a hi-tech, purpose built theatre in Al Habtoor City, is the hottest ticket in town. Featuring world-class acrobats diving from a height of 25m and ‘flying’ around the auditorium on high-powered winches at speeds of up to 15km/h, it is a sight to behold. But you’d expect nothing less from legendary artistic director Franco Dragone. The force behind sell-out spectaculars around the world, Franco has pulled out all the stops to ensure La Perle raises the bar for entertainment in the region.

During the show, water takes a starring role – all 2.7 million litres of it. Watch in wonder as the stage transforms from wet to dry back again in a matter of seconds. It is a visual and emotional experience that, in the words of the show’s founder, “will ignite the heart and soul of everyone in the audience and will have people sitting on the edge of their chairs”.

“I first started working with water when I directed the show O in Las Vegas,” he reveals. “Initially, I was scared to work with water but, in fact, the water helped me to calm down because you have to follow the water. The water flows – you have to become the water and understand it.”

Out of the ordinary

Inspired by Dubai, a place that Dragone refers to as the “laboratory of the future,” the grand production fuses the finest in artistic performance, creative imagery and brilliant technology.

Bringing the vision to life has been years in the making. “When I begin to work on the show, I look and listen and try to emerge myself in the region and into the eyes of the people,” says Franco. “This is an audacious adventure. This is a complex show, the likes of which has never been done in Dubai before.


 

La Perle is a show that combines the spirit of Dubai with an iconic 860sqm ‘aqua-stage’. The custom-built theatre was constructed around the show’s concept and is inspired by the vibrancy of this city. La Perle has it all – cascading waterfalls, fast-paced acrobatics, a 25m high dive and fantastical characters. Dragone hopes the production leaves visitors enthraled and makes them forget the world outside the theatre for a couple of hours. “We are dreamers, but we also want to have an impact and we hope that is a little bit of peace, a little flavour of eternity,” he said.

Just the ticket

The 1,300 seat venue is designed for maximum impact. With only 14 rows, seating is wrapped 270 degrees around the aqua-stage, creating an intimate experience. There’s no room for disappointment as every seat offers its own unique views. We’d recommend booking in Row N for the Silver category or Row A in Gold for a more central perspective.

For a special occasion, splurge on a VIP ticket. You’ll be welcomed to a private lounge for pre-show bites before being escorted to luxurious theatre lounge chairs, positioned for premium views.  Nights out in Dubai present the perfect excuse to glam up so remember to dress to impress!

There’s much to explore at Al Habtoor City on Sheikh Zayed Road. The district comprises three five-star hotels, a vibrant marina promenade as well as stylish cafes and restaurants. For a memorable dinner, book a table at British eatery Rose and Crown at The Atrium, or savour signature French fare at BQ - French Kitchen, located at Habtoor Palace.

A short 20-minute drive from the airport, you can easily hail a taxi to Al Habtoor City from the roadside or pre-book one by calling +971 4 208 0808. If you’re arriving via the Dubai Metro, just alight at the Business Bay metro station on the Red Line and La Perle is a quick five-minute taxi ride away.

When’s the next show?

La Perle takes place twice a night, five days a week. Performances from Tuesday to Friday are at 7pm and 9:30pm, and Saturdays at 4pm and 7pm. Check out Dubai Calendar for all the latest listings.
